  1. Improve Lighting Throughout Your Home

Lighting can completely change the mood of your space. Combine:

  • Ambient lighting for general brightness
  • Task lighting for functionality
  • Accent lighting for style

Well-lit homes feel bigger, cleaner, and more welcoming.

DIY vs. Professional Upgrades

DIY Projects

  • Painting
  • Installing shelves
  • Minor decor updates

Hire Professionals For

  • Electrical work
  • Plumbing
  • Structural changes

Knowing when to DIY and when to hire experts can save time and money.
